for those who will assume that 'privilege' only refers to one's race
FIRST, the definition of Privilege: : a right or immunity granted as a peculiar benefit, advantage, or favor
SECOND, what it means to be Favored: providing preferential treatment

1. Race and ethnicity
- Racial issues are a huge problem today in the United States. According to US News, about 60% of non-black people believe that black people are less intelligent than white people. It is also more likely for a convicted white man to be hired over a black man with no criminal record.
2. Sexual orientation
- Identifying as straight is considered the norm in our society. Anyone that isn't straight usually has to "come out," which can be a terrifying experience. Many of those in the LGBTQ+ community hide their sexualities for protection from "social shame.
3. Gender and Gender Identity
4. Financial situation
5. Disability
- Besides already making life difficult for someone, disabilities also come with stigma. For example, people with mental illnesses are often labelled as "crazy" and people try to avoid them. This prevents people from getting help for their disabilities.
6. Religion
- Certain religions are targeted more than others. The largest religions attacked in hate crimes are Judaism, Islam and ethnic religions. Recently, Islam has been heavily attacked due to terrorist groups such as ISIS who claim that they are representatives of the religion. However, we must remember that every religion has extremists, and those cannot represent the majority of the faith practicers.
7. Citizenship
- Non-citizens can attend American universities, but have limits on where they can work and how long they can stay, despite being financially essential to universities.
8. Educational level
-81% of high school students graduate. If you are enrolled in university, you are already privileged, even if you worked for this privilege. Many people can not attend school for financial or personal reasons.
About 60% of college students graduate. Dropouts face higher rates of unemployment. Degrees are not as common as we think.
